What will the weather in Ha Giang be like during my visit?
The warmest months in Ha Giang are usually May and June, with an average temperature of 21°C. January and December are the chilliest months, when the average temperature is 12°C. The rainiest months are August and July.

Ha Giang: A Tapestry of Mountains, Flowers, and Hidden Treasures
Nestled in the northern highlands of Vietnam, Ha Giang in Tuyen Quang Province is a breathtaking off-the-beaten-path gem. Renowned for its dramatic mountain landscapes, vibrant flower fields, and rich ethnic culture, this region invites adventurous souls to explore its winding roads and serene small towns. Key attractions include the stunning Ma Pi Leng Pass, the terraced rice fields of Hoang Su Phi, and the unique markets of local tribes. Whether trekking through lush forests or immersing oneself in traditional customs, Ha Giang promises an unforgettable experience steeped in natural beauty and cultural richness.

Best time to go to Ha Giang
Ha Giang exper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 49.8°F (9.9°C), while June is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 70.3°F (21.3°C). August is usually the wettest month. September to November are the peak travel months in Ha Giang, attracting a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is mostly cloudy, accompanied by no to light rainfall. On the other hand, March, May, and June tend to be quieter times to visit, marked by no to moderate rainfall and mostly sunny to mostly cloudy conditions.
